Description

The small island nation of Vanuatu in the Southwest Pacific has completed a pilot study of well-being that looks beyond income, health, and education factors. Jamie Tanguay presents key findings from the study, and the potential impact they have on policy. Jamie Tanguay is the Coordinator of Alternative Indicators of Well-Being for Melanesia.
